Hadīth explanation: The believer who is promised Paradise (in the Qur'an and Sunnah), if he had true knowledge of the punishment and torture that Allah has prepared for the people of disbelief and falsehood, he would not have any hope of entering Paradise; rather, his only hope would be to be saved from Hellfire, given what it contains of severe torture that human bodies would cannot bear. Contrary to that, if the disbeliever had true knowledge of the mercy of Allah, the Most Merciful and Most Generous, he would not despair of Allah's mercy; rather he would hope to enter Paradise because of what he knows about Allah's vast and extensive mercy and forgiveness.
